Transaction eafabc675e3dc0a9653ea427b77838ff82f7658f4cb6786bbd438224bf6be8c1
1 Input
1 Output
-
eafabc675e3dc0a9653ea427b77838ff82f7658f4cb6786bbd438224bf6be8c1:0
- value
- 834526291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8078422db1e9ebf11dabaa6e28f8aff144ed107c OP_EQUAL
- address
- 3DQJUogw2MbiWyBeH15qzDpDZjdCYGzS1h